How to Choose a Carbide End Mill Cutter
For Aluminum and Soft Metals
Aluminium, Kupfer, and other soft metals usually need better chip evacuation. daher, 2-flute or 3-flute carbide end mill cutters often work well for high-speed cutting and smooth chip removal.
For Steel and Stainless Steel
Für Stahl und Edelstahl, 4-flute or 6-flute carbide end mills are more suitable. Zusätzlich, TiAlN or AlCrN coatings can help improve heat resistance and extend tool life.
For Mold Machining
For mold making, tool accuracy and surface finish are very important. Flat end mills can handle general slotting and finishing. In der Zwischenzeit, bull nose end mills and ball nose end mills are suitable for corner radius machining, 3D-Konturierung, and mold cavity machining.

For Roughing and Finishing
Roughing operations usually need stronger cutting edges and better chip removal. Finishing operations need higher precision, smoother cutting, and better surface quality. daher, the flute number, Beschichtung, and tool geometry should match the machining process.

Which coating is suitable for carbide end mill cutters?
TiAlN and AlCrN coatings are commonly used for steel and stainless steel. Uncoated or special coatings can be selected for aluminum and non-ferrous materials. The best coating depends on the material, cutting speed, and machining condition.
What is the difference between a carbide end mill cutter and a carbide milling cutter?
A carbide end mill cutter is a specific type of carbide milling cutter. It is mainly used for end milling, Schlitzen, Taschenfräsen, Konturierung, und Seitenschneiden. A carbide milling cutter is a broader term and can also include side milling cutters, T-slot cutters, face cutters, roughing cutters, and custom carbide cutters.
